# How to Choose the Right Web Development Agency in 2025
Choosing the right web development agency is one of the most critical decisions for your business's digital success. With countless agencies claiming to be the best, how do you separate the wheat from the chaff? This comprehensive guide will walk you through the essential criteria and red flags to watch for when selecting your web development partner.
## Why Choosing the Right Agency Matters
Your website is often the first impression potential customers have of your business. A poorly designed or developed site can drive customers away, while a professional, well-functioning website can significantly boost your credibility and sales. The right agency will:
- Understand your business goals and target audience
- Deliver a website that reflects your brand identity
- Provide ongoing support and maintenance
- Help you achieve your digital marketing objectives
- Offer transparent pricing and clear communication
## Essential Criteria for Agency Selection
### 1. Portfolio and Experience
**What to Look For:**
- Diverse portfolio showcasing different industries and project types
- Case studies with measurable results
- Experience with businesses similar to yours
- Examples of responsive, mobile-friendly designs
- Recent work (within the last 2 years)
**Questions to Ask:**
- Can you show me examples of projects similar to mine?
- What were the results achieved for your clients?
- Do you have experience in my industry?
- Can you provide client references?
### 2. Technical Expertise
**Key Technical Skills:**
- Modern web technologies (React, Next.js, Node.js)
- Mobile-first responsive design
- SEO optimization capabilities
- Security best practices
- Performance optimization
- Cross-browser compatibility
**Red Flags:**
- Agencies still using outdated technologies
- No mention of mobile optimization
- Lack of SEO knowledge
- No security considerations
### 3. Communication and Project Management
**Essential Communication Elements:**
- Clear project timeline and milestones
- Regular progress updates
- Responsive communication (24-48 hour response time)
- Dedicated project manager or point of contact
- Clear documentation and handover process
**Questions to Ask:**
- How often will you provide project updates?
- Who will be my main point of contact?
- What's your typical response time for questions?
- How do you handle project changes or scope creep?
### 4. Pricing and Value
**Pricing Considerations:**
- Transparent, detailed pricing structure
- No hidden fees or surprise costs
- Clear understanding of what's included
- Payment terms and schedule
- Value for money compared to competitors
**Warning Signs:**
- Extremely low prices (often indicates poor quality)
- Vague pricing without detailed breakdowns
- Pressure to sign immediately
- No written contract or agreement
### 5. Support and Maintenance
**Post-Launch Support:**
- Training on how to manage your website
- Ongoing maintenance and updates
- Technical support availability
- Backup and security monitoring
- Content management system training
## Industry-Specific Considerations
### For E-commerce Businesses
- Experience with payment gateway integration
- Inventory management capabilities
- Security compliance (PCI DSS)
- Mobile shopping optimization
- Performance with large product catalogs
### For Service Businesses
- [Online booking system integration](/services/scheduling)
- Lead generation optimization
- Local SEO capabilities
- Customer testimonial features
- Contact form optimization
### For Professional Services
- Client portal development
- Document management systems
- Appointment scheduling
- Billing integration
- Professional design aesthetics
## Red Flags to Avoid
### 1. Lack of Transparency
- Unwilling to provide detailed proposals
- Vague about project timelines
- Refuses to share portfolio examples
- No clear communication about costs
### 2. Outdated Practices
- Still using Flash or outdated technologies
- No mobile optimization strategy
- Ignoring SEO best practices
- No security considerations
### 3. Poor Communication
- Slow response times
- Unprofessional communication
- No project management process
- Lack of regular updates
### 4. Unrealistic Promises
- Guaranteed #1 Google ranking
- Extremely fast delivery times
- Unrealistically low prices
- Promises without supporting evidence
## The Selection Process
### Step 1: Define Your Requirements
Before reaching out to agencies, clearly define:
- Your business goals and objectives
- Target audience and market
- Required features and functionality
- Budget range
- Timeline expectations
- Maintenance and support needs
### Step 2: Research and Shortlist
- Search for agencies with relevant experience
- Read reviews and testimonials
- Check their portfolio and case studies
- Look for industry recognition or awards
- Ask for recommendations from business contacts
### Step 3: Request Proposals
Send detailed RFPs (Request for Proposals) to 3-5 agencies including:
- Project overview and requirements
- Timeline expectations
- Budget range
- Specific questions about their process
- Request for portfolio examples
### Step 4: Evaluate Proposals
Compare proposals based on:
- Understanding of your requirements
- Proposed solution and approach
- Timeline and milestones
- Pricing and value
- Team composition and experience
### Step 5: Conduct Interviews
Schedule calls or meetings to:
- Discuss the project in detail
- Meet the team who will work on your project
- Ask specific technical questions
- Evaluate communication style and responsiveness
- Discuss post-launch support
## Questions to Ask During Interviews
### About Their Process
- What's your typical project workflow?
- How do you handle project changes?
- What's your quality assurance process?
- How do you ensure timely delivery?
### About Their Team
- Who will be working on my project?
- What are their qualifications and experience?
- Will I have a dedicated project manager?
- How do you handle team changes during the project?
### About Support and Maintenance
- What support do you provide after launch?
- How do you handle website updates and maintenance?
- What's included in your ongoing support?
- How do you handle security updates?
## Making the Final Decision
### Consider These Factors:
1. **Cultural Fit**: Do you work well together?
2. **Technical Capability**: Can they deliver what you need?
3. **Communication**: Are they responsive and clear?
4. **Value**: Do you get good value for your investment?
5. **Long-term Partnership**: Can they grow with your business?
### Trust Your Instincts
If something feels off during the selection process, trust your instincts. A good working relationship is crucial for project success.
## Common Mistakes to Avoid
### 1. Choosing Based on Price Alone
The cheapest option often costs more in the long run due to poor quality, delays, or additional work needed.
### 2. Ignoring the Team
The agency's team will be working on your project. Ensure they have the right skills and experience.
### 3. Not Checking References
Always speak with previous clients to understand their experience and results.
### 4. Rushing the Decision
Take time to properly evaluate all options. A rushed decision often leads to regret.
### 5. Not Having a Written Contract
Ensure all terms, timelines, and deliverables are clearly documented in writing.
## Conclusion
Choosing the right web development agency is a crucial decision that will impact your business's online success for years to come. By following the criteria and process outlined in this guide, you can make an informed decision that leads to a successful partnership and a website that drives your business forward.
Remember, the best agency for your business is one that understands your goals, has the technical expertise to deliver, communicates clearly, and offers ongoing support. Take your time, ask the right questions, and trust your instincts.
---
*Ready to find the perfect web development partner? [Contact our team](/contact) for a free consultation. We specialize in [professional business websites](/services) with transparent pricing and direct communication. Check out our [portfolio](/portfolio) to see examples of our work, or learn more about our [development process](/about) and how we can help your business succeed online.*
*Looking for specific services? Explore our [e-commerce solutions](/services), [SEO services](/services), or our [free booking system integration](/services/scheduling) that we include with every website project.*
16/1/20256 min readBy VotreProjet.site
Cómo elegir la agencia de desarrollo web correcta en 2025
Aprende los criterios esenciales para seleccionar una agencia de desarrollo web. Evita errores costosos con nuestra guía experta.
web developmentagency selectionbusiness guidewebsite planning
¿Listo para Transformar tu Negocio?
Hablemos de cómo podemos ayudarte a alcanzar tus objetivos en línea con nuestros servicios de desarrollo web profesionales.
Artículos Relacionados
13/2/20255 min read
Freelance Web Developer vs Agency: Which is Right for You?
Compare freelance developers vs agencies for your web project. Make the right choice with our detailed comparison guide.
Leer Más12/2/20255 min read
Website Maintenance Checklist: Keep Your Site Running Smoothly
Essential website maintenance tasks for business owners. Keep your site secure, fast, and up-to-date with this checklist.
Leer Más11/2/20255 min read
Website Project Timeline Planning: Realistic Expectations
Plan your website project timeline effectively. Learn realistic timeframes for different types of web development projects.
Leer Más